Sea of ​​Thieves, the latest Microsoft game, has passed two million players

The title Sea of ​​Thieves is being a success for Microsoft, since the game has more than two million players, a milestone achieved in just eight days after its launch.

After many years in the shadow of Sony, Microsoft is finally seeing the light and the stakes are going wonderfully. The latest Microsoft success is thanks to Rare, who were in charge of developing Sea of ​​Thieves, a title that has garnered an impressive figure of two million players, which was reached on March 28, just 8 days after its release. launch (March 20). The most impressive thing was that in 24 hours they had sold the first million copies.

Microsoft is betting more on games for Windows 10 and Xbox One and working to have quality titles, although they are not yet finished, as is the case of PlayerUnknown's Battlegrounds, while Sony, which believed it had a monopoly on consoles, is lagging behind in terms of attractive launches and that report increases in audience. Microsoft has also opted to copy Steam's Early Access program, something that has also been a success

Returning to the Sea of ​​Thieves, we must say that the game had many problems at the beginning, due to the avalanche of players, completely unexpected, to the point, that they have closed servers and even temporarily disabled the obtaining of achievements, already that there were problems, due to the saturation of the servers.

This title on Xbox Live has garnered large numbers, generating half a million alliances between players and 400.000 players have joined the Xbox Club, with the intention of sharing a promenade.
